How to Declutter Your Windows Context Menu [Windows Tip]

November 21st, 2008

Windows tip: Whether you use them or not, many applications install superfluous entries to your Windows right-click context menu resulting in a cluttered mess. The How-To Geek weblog details how to clean up your messy Windows context menu using a variety of methods, from manual registry hacks to using the simple, previously mentioned ShellExView. If you steer clear of the right-click because it’s become such a cluttered mess, do yourself a favor by cleaning it and customizing it to fit your needs.
